Everton have finally announced the signing of Senegal international forward Iliman Ndiaye. [RBM]
Everton sign trialist and former Arsenal youth forward Omari Benjamin to permanent deal. [RBM]
The latest class of Everton scholars have been announced; Leighton Baines should have a solid crop of players for his Under-18 squad this season, including goalie Douglass Lukjanciks who’s being closely watched by Manchester City. [EFC]

Blues linked with promising Lyon defender Jake O’Brien, but they face West Ham competition. [NY Times]
️Everton are tracking Lyon Defender, Jake O’Brien. West Ham and Nottingham Forest also hold an interest. Lyon want more than the £17M plus add-ons approach they have already received

Ipswich Town look to be leading the race for Everton-linked defender Jacob Greaves. [TEAMtalk]
Amadou Onana impresses, but his Belgian side fall 1-0 to France. [EFC]
Amadou Onana’s game by numbers vs. France:
100% dribbles completed
100% tackles won
92% pass accuracy
4/5 ground duels won
4/5 long passes completed
